Chattogram: Bangladesh women beat Pakistan women by 20 runs to gain an unassailable 2-0 lead in the three-match series at the Zahur Ahmed Chowdhury Stadium in Chattogram on Friday evening. The third T20I match of the series will be played on Sunday at the same venue.
Chasing 121 to win, Pakistan finished their innings at 100-7 in the allotted 20 overs. Experienced batter Bismah Maroof, who top-scored with 30 off 44 deliveries, Iram Javed (15, 17b, 1x4) and Umm-e-Hani (14, 14b, 1x4) were the only batters to reach double figures for Pakistan.
Bangladesh left-arm spinner Nahida Akter, who took a five-fer in the previous game, once again shone with the ball taking two wickets and giving away 15 runs in her four overs. Rabeya Khan also got two wickets while Fahima Khatun and Marufa Akter took one wicket apiece.
Earlier, after being put into bat Bangladesh managed to score 120 for six in 20 overs. During the batting powerplay, Bangladesh batters accumulated 48 runs for the loss of one wicket. The bowlers pulled off well and conceded only 72 runs and took five wickets in the remaining 14 overs of the innings.
Off-spinner Umm-e-Hani, who bowled economically in the first T20I, gave away only 12 runs today in her spell of four overs and clinched the wicket of opening batter Murshida Khatun (20, 28b, 2x4s). The off-spinner was equally supported by left-arm spinners Nashra Sundhu and Sadia Iqbal – both bagged a wicket each for 16 and 24 runs, respectively.
Right-arm fast Diana Baig was the most successful bowler for the tourists, grabbing two wickets for 34 runs in four overs.
That the hosts were able to score 120 in 20 overs was due to a quick-fire unbeaten knock by Shorna Akter, who top-scored for her side with a 22-ball 27, hitting a four and a six.
Scores in brief:
Bangladesh women beat Pakistan women by 20 runs
Bangladesh 120-6, 20 overs (Shorna Akter 27 not out, Murshida Khatun 20; Diana Baig 2-34)
Pakistan 100-7, 20 overs (Bismah Maroof 30; Nahida Akter 2-15, Rabeya Khan 2-21)
Player of the match – Shorna Akter (Bangladesh women)
Third T20I at Zahur Ahmed Chowdhury Stadium, Chattogram on 29 October
